What to Eat
Thalassery is known for its delicious cuisine. Some of the most popular dishes include:
- Thalassery biryani: This is a flavorful biryani made with rice, meat, and spices.
- Kappa and meen curry: This is a traditional dish made with tapioca and fish curry.
- Puttu and kadala curry: This is a steamed rice cake served with a black chickpea curry.
